Tech Support Scams — What They Look Like and How to Shut Them Down #
Since you are reading this I will assume that you’ve probably seen one of these:
A browser window suddenly claims your machine is infected with a virus or possessed by a hacker.
A phone call claiming to be from “Microsoft Support” or another recognizable company.
An email says you’ve been charged for something you didn’t buy and to call immediately to be refunded or cancel the order.
These are tech support scams — and they’re still one of the most common fraud tactics in circulation. They don’t rely on sophisticated hacking. They rely on panic, urgency, and social engineering.
According to the FBI and the FTC, scammers use these methods because they consistently lead victims to grant remote access or make payments under pressure.
